SETSITE.IN Browser Hijacker Manual Removal Guide
This redirect virus is an infamous browser hijacker that can secretly move into your system and do malicious thing to computer. Note that manual removal is recommended for advanced users only because it is a complicated and difficult process requires enough computer skills. Here we provide the steps of manually removing the nasty browser hijacker from your computer (Please be careful when handling the deletion of files and registry entries).
1. Stop running processes related to this redirect virus.
a: When the Windows Task manager appears, switch to Processes tab.
b: Find out and select the processes related to the virus by name random.exe, and click on the “End process” button.
Remove the redirect virus from Internet Explorer:
a: Start IE, go to Tools and select Internet Options.
b: Find General section, remove SETSITE.IN address as a home page.
c: Then go to Search section, find Settings button and choose Manage Add-ons
d: Erase the redirect and after the action, close Manage Add-ons
2. Remove the redirect virus from Mozilla Firefox.
a: Open Mozilla Firefox browser, click on tools and go to Options.
b: Switch to General tab, remove SETSITE.IN address as a startup site.
c: Then, go to: Firefox -> Add-ons -> Add-ons Manager -> Remove.
d: In the Search list, select Manage Search Engines and erase this redirect and choose OK
3. Remove the redirect virus from Google Chrome.
a: Open Google Chrome and navigate to Settings tab and Set pages.
b: Erase SETSITE.IN which was seta as the startup site and choose OK
c: Find Manage search engines and here, erase this redirect.
d: Press on OK, and restart Google Chrome.
4. Delete all registry files created by this redirect virus.
a. While the Registry Editor is opened, search for the registry key “H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\ SETSITE.IN.” Right-click this registry key and select “Delete.”
